Bug Description

Binary package hint: fast-user-switch-applet

Found in Fast User Switch Applet 2.24.0/Ubuntu 9.04 Alpha.

If gedit is open, the Fast User Switch Applet will not allow me to do a quick restart - it shows a dialog that says that "Text Editor" is blocking log out. This happens even when I have no unsaved changes in gedit.

How to reproduce:
1) Make sure you have gedit open, with no unsaved changes.
2) Click on the Fast User Switch Applet icon.
3) Choose Restart from the pull-down menu.

Expected behavior: The system should initiate a restart.
Actual behavior: A caption-less dialog appears, having the text "A program is still running" and showing the gedit icon.

100 % reproducible.

If I choose Restart from the dialog that comes up when I choose Shutdown from the System menu, I don't get the same blocking behavior. Therefore I'm reporting this problem on the fast-user-switch-applet package, although there might just as well be something in gedit that's causing it.

Chris Coulson (chrisccoulson) wrote :

Thats not anything to do with the fast-user-switch-applet. gnome-session displays that dialog, but it is gedit that inhibits the session. I'll re-assign this to gedit, but I don't think it's a bug. This is intended behaviour. Does it happen even when there are no unsaved changes in gedit?
